Erb's Palsy Attorney

Nothing is more devastation to families than finding out that your baby child has an illness that is severe. If your child has suffered birth injury, such as Erb's palsy, an attorney will help you seek compensation to cover the care of your child.

Your lawyer will rely on hospital records, witness statements, and more to build strong arguments on your behalf. They will also consider any future treatment that may be required.

Compensation

Compensation awarded in the event of a successful Erb's Palsy case can help families pay for the costs of treatment. Additionally the legal process may also provide a sense of closure for families and keep medical professionals accountable. Many children suffering from Erb's paralysis require physical therapy, surgery, and other expensive medical procedures.

Damage to the brachialplexus, which is a bundle of nerves located in the shoulder, can cause a child's arm movements to be affected. The injury may cause a variety of symptoms, such as weakness or paralysis. The condition is usually caused by excessive pulling on the shoulders during labor and birth. Fortunately, the majority of cases can be prevented with appropriate medical care.

An experienced Erb’s palsy lawyer can review the details in your child's case to determine if there is a reason to file a medical malpractice claim. Typically, the claim must be filed within the prescribed timeframe of limitations, which is different by state. If you don't file it by the deadline, you won't be able to bring a medical negligence lawsuit.

Mediation

In a mediation session attorneys and clients discuss their respective positions. They may also bring in experts to support their argument. The goal is to come to an agreement that is satisfactory to both parties. This process is usually quicker and more affordable than an experiment. It is not always successful.

erb's palsy settlement (visit the up coming internet site) Palsy is a result of an injury at birth that causes the brachial plexus is stretched or damaged. This condition can cause serious complications, such as a lack of mobility, loss in arm usage, and depression. Many people suffering from this disorder are unable to work or participate in sports. They are also unable to do their jobs or take care of themselves.

Most cases of this condition are due to medical negligence. This could be due to any failure on the part of doctors to ensure that their patients are safe during labor and delivery. It could also involve the use of force that is excessive. In some cases the force could cause the shoulder to get stuck against the pubic bone, which is a condition called shoulder dystocia.

A lawyer can help families file a lawsuit against the medical professionals responsible for the birth injury. A legal team will gather evidence, including medical records and personal accounts. The lawyers will present their case to a mediator, who will try to negotiate a solution with both parties. If there is a settlement both parties will be compensated for their injuries.
